Scalable controller design for discrete-time multi-agent consensus systems

This paper investigates discrete-time multi-agent single-input consensus systems in regard to the control design and scalability. In particular, we propose a new controller design that handles any number of connected agents and various communication structures, belonging to a defined group of graphs, without the need to change the individual controller of the agents. We give a rigorous proof that the resulting system achieves consensus.
